چکیده مقاله:

The current article reviews the clinical presentations of immune-mediated cerebellar ataxia and analyzes the association with autoantibodies. Emerging evidence suggests that autoimmunity is involved in a significant proportion of patients presented with ataxia. Moreover,numerous autoantibodies have recently been described in association with cerebellar ataxias. The cerebellum is a vulnerable target of autoimmunity in the CNS and immune-mediated cerebellar ataxia is an important differential diagnosis in patients presenting with signsand symptoms of cerebellar disease. Immune-mediated cerebellar ataxias include gluten ataxia, paraneoplastic cerebellar degeneration, GAD antibody associated cerebellar ataxia, and Hashimoto’s encephalopathy among others. More than 30 different autoantibodiestargeting brain antigens have been reported in patients with Immune-mediated cerebellar ataxias, many of which are of paraneoplastic origin. Efficient biomarkers are still lacking and in many cases the diagnosis has to rely on a body of converging evidence
